Default Which carrier series do I have??

Hey guys, I'm looking for a new gear and I don't know if I have a 2 or 3 series carrier. Can you guys help me out?

It's a 2000 Z28 A4 with stock 2.73's

2 series: 2.73
3 series: 3.23 and up
3 channel: ABS
4 channel: ABS + Traction control
3 channel: single reluctor wheel on the posi unit
4 channel: 2 reluctors, one on each axle end out by the brakes
